BCW Celebrates Summer with VIP Member Reception

From left, BCW Chairman of the Board Jamie Schutzer of Alera Group; Daniella Schiano of Balancing Life’s Issues; Carrie Gallagher of Balancing Life’s Issues; Lily Braswell, General Manager, Trump National Golf Club and BCW President & CEO Marsha Gordon  

The Business Council of Westchester (BCW) hosted its exclusive VIP Member Summer Reception on Tuesday at the Trump National Golf Club Westchester in Briarcliff Manor.

The elegant gathering brought together approximately 125 guests for an evening of networking and connection amid the stunning Trump National Golf Club Westchester. Attendees enjoyed the club’s renowned five-star private club amenities, set within a friendly, family-oriented atmosphere that includes the largest pool in Westchester County and remarkable Har-Tru surface tennis courts surrounded by beautiful stone.

The reception featured delightful music by Hal Prince Entertainment. The BCW extends its gratitude to the event’s sponsors: Balancing Life’s Issues, Co-Communications, and Heineken, and to Event Partner Zaro’s Family Bakery, for their generous support in making this evening a success.

Events like the VIP Summer Reception provide invaluable face-to-face time, fostering stronger relationships and deeper engagement within the BCW community.
